Demystifying Ad Network Pricing Structures

Navigating the intricate of ad network pricing structures can be a daunting task for advertisers. However, by deciphering the fundamental concepts, you can effectively optimize your advertising budget and maximize your return on investment.

Ad networks typically employ various pricing models, such as pay-per-click (PPC), cost per view, and performance-based. Each model deviates in terms of how advertisers are charged.

Consider, CPC pricing revolves around paying a fee for every click on your advertisement. On the other hand, CPM pricing charges advertisers based on the quantity of impressions their ads receive.

Understanding these different pricing structures is crucial for creating a successful advertising strategy.

By carefully assessing your campaign targets and grasping the nuances of each pricing model, you can make informed decisions that match with your budget and enhance your advertising ROI.
